Direction to Centre on crop insurance

Staff Reporter

BANGALORE: A Division Bench comprising Chief Justice Nauvdip Kumar Sodhi and Justice N. Kumar on Thursday directed the Union Government to take a decision by December 31 on the revised crop insurance scheme so that the difficulties faced by farmers will be expeditiously remedied.

The Bench was hearing petitions by Suresh Gopal M. and others, all farmers from Haliyal, Mundgod and Sirsi taluks, on the problems being faced by those who have insured their crops under the scheme. The State Government told the court that it had received suggestions from the farmers and forwarded them to the Centre. The Union Government had said that the suggestions from all States have been placed before a group.
